My Mexico experience

Welp I am back from having my surgery and things are going good.

First I would like to say that I couldn't have gone with a better

group of women. Caprise, , and Ruby were awesome and Ingrid

(Capris's friend) was super great. It really helped to have someone

there that wasn't having surgery. Ignrid you were so much fun! I will

always remember our crazy taxi ride to get tequila the day after I

had surgery. I have done some crazy things in my life but I think

that topped it lol.

For anyone who is scared to go to Mexico to have surgery I am here to

tell you that there is not one thing to be scared of. I was a little

nervous about going but once I got there and saw Mexicali and met

Yolanda, Dr. Aceves, , and Nina I KNEW I was in great hands.

Dr. Aceves is a very soft spoken, knowledgeable man and one of the

BEST Doctor's I have met. He answered every single question we had

and made us feel right at home. Dr. Aveces visited me twice before

surgery and three times the day after surgery. He seemes to be very

concerned about how you are doing before and after surgery. I have

not one thing bad to say about Dr. Aceves or his staff. is

also a very soft spoken young man that is very caring and loving. He

held my hand while I had my IV because he knew I was scared. Yolanda

is one of the happiest funniest people. She will make you laugh so

hard even though it hurts lol. Nina is BEAUTIFUL! What I would do for

a body like that and oh my goodness is she just the sweetest!

I had some major shoulder pain when I arrived home and had to see my

Doctor here in Oregon today. He gave me some liquid pain medicine and

now I feel fine. My right leg is going numb but Nina said that might

be due to the shot they give you in your leg during surgery. My

incision's look great and I have already lost 8 pounds.

I have been reading the post's about the horrible fill's that yall

have been getting. Since my flight was over booked on my way to San

Diego I was given a later flight and a free round trip ticket to use

any time so I plan on going to see Dr. Aceves to get my first fill

and hopefully every fill after that. I wish all of you the best of

luck and hope that yall can find a fill Doctor that know's what they

are doing.
